Mandeville, LA—nestled on the northern shore of Lake Pontchartrain, is a picturesque city known for its historic charm, natural beauty, and bustling community life. Established in 1834, Mandeville has a rich history reflected in its well-preserved architecture and quaint downtown area. The city is renowned for its scenic waterfront, lush parks, and extensive trail systems. Mandeville offers a high quality of life with its blend of small-town charm and modern amenities, making it an attractive destination for families, retirees, and professionals.

The real estate market in Mandeville is diverse, featuring a mix of historic homes, modern single-family residences, and upscale condominiums. The median home price is approximately $350,000, reflecting the area's desirability and high standard of living. The city's neighborhoods—such as Beau Chene and The Sanctuary—are known for their tree-lined streets, well-maintained properties, and community-oriented atmosphere. Mandeville's housing market caters to a wide range of preferences and budgets, from charming bungalows to luxurious waterfront estates. Mandeville is served by the St. Tammany Parish Public School System, which is highly regarded for its academic excellence and comprehensive educational programs. Schools such as Mandeville High School, Lakeshore High School, and Pontchartrain Elementary School are known for their strong academic performance and extracurricular offerings. The city also boasts several private schools, including Cedarwood School and Our Lady of the Lake Roman Catholic School, providing additional educational choices for families. Higher education opportunities are available at nearby institutions such as Southeastern Louisiana University and Northshore Technical Community College. The employment landscape in Mandeville is diverse, with a strong emphasis on healthcare, education, retail, and professional services. Major employers in the area include the St. Tammany Parish Hospital, the St. Tammany Parish Public School System, and various local businesses. The city's proximity to New Orleans—just across Lake Pontchartrain via the Causeway Bridge—expands employment opportunities for residents, providing access to a broader job market. Mandeville's economy is also supported by a thriving tourism industry, which benefits from the city's scenic beauty, historic sites, and recreational offerings.
Mandeville offers a wealth of recreational and cultural activities for residents and visitors alike. Outdoor enthusiasts can enjoy the Tammany Trace—a 31-mile rail-to-trail path perfect for biking, jogging, and walking. Fontainebleau State Park—with its beautiful beachfront, nature trails, and camping facilities—is a favorite destination for families and nature lovers. Mandeville's historic district features charming shops, cafes, and galleries, providing a pleasant setting for a leisurely stroll. The city hosts several annual events, including the Mandeville Seafood Festival and the Wooden Boat Festival, which celebrate the area's heritage and community spirit.
